A 600kg car is at rest, and then it accelerates to 5 m/s.

Answer:

1. 0 J

2. 7500 J

3. 7500 J

Explanation:

From the question given above, the following data were obtained:

Mass (m) of car = 600 Kg

Initial velocity (v₁) of car = 0 m/s

Final velocity (v₂) of car = 5 m/s

Original kinetic energy (KE₁) =?

Final kinetic energy (KE₂) =?

Work used =?

1. Determination of the original kinetic energy.

Mass (m) of car = 600 Kg

Initial velocity (v₁) of car = 0 m/s

Original kinetic energy (KE₁) =?

KE₁ = ½mv₁²

KE₁ = ½ × 600 × 0²

KE₁ = 0 J

Thus, the original kinetic energy of the car is 0 J.

2. Determination of the final kinetic energy.

Mass (m) of car = 600 Kg

Final velocity (v₂) of car = 5 m/s

Final kinetic energy (KE₂) =?

KE₂ = ½mv₂²

KE₂ = ½ × 600 × 5²

KE₂ = 300 × 25

KE₂ = 7500 J

Thus, the final kinetic energy of the car is 7500 J

3. Determination of the work used.

Original kinetic energy (KE₁) = 0

Final kinetic energy (KE₂) = 7500 J

Work used =?

Work used = KE₂ – KE₁

Work used = 7500 – 0

Work used = 7500 J
